6-inch wood chippers in Abbeyhill
A 6-inch chipper takes care of branches with diameters up to 150mm (6 inches), suitable for most domestic garden jobs, hedge trimming, and small-scale arboricultural work. The manageable towable 6-inch models from Forst are built to move through typical garden gates and can be conveniently towed using a van or pick-up.
If your primary concern is who has a primary focus is centred around domestic gardens, periodic hedge trimming work and the occasional small tree removal, a 6-inch chipper remains more than capable. This versatile tool takes care of such tasks with little effort, providing the perfect balance without saddling you with the unnecessary heft and additional expense that typically accompanies larger machinery.
The six-inch versions come with a weight of less than 750kg, enabling them to be towed with just a standard driving licence, eliminating the need for a B+E towing qualification. This is particularly important when your workforce includes team members who do not have the supplementary licence category.
8-inch wood chippers in Abbeyhill
An 8-inch chipper deals with branches up to 200mm (eight inches) diameter with greater speed thanks to its larger feed chute and more robust engine. Forst’s 8-inch models are available in both towable and tracked versions, made especially for tree care professionals, large-scale site clearance, and intensive workdays where non-stop chipping run from dawn until dusk.
Wow, isn’t it amazing the amount of time saved when you’re processing bigger branches? With an 8-inch machine, you can feed everything in whole instead of constantly cross-cutting to fit a 6-inch throat! On those intense days, all that saved cross-cutting time really accumulates impressively. Of course, there’s a balance to think about – most 8-inch machines are bulkier (typically requiring a B+E licence for towing) and they come at a higher price to hire or buy. But for high-output teams, the substantial boost in productivity quickly covers the extra expense!
Towable vs Tracked Wood Chippers
Towable chippers are mounted on road-legal chassis systems that fix to your vehicle for moving to the worksite. These provide the optimal choice for the vast majority of operations because one simply travels to the location, uncouples the equipment, and begins the chipping process. Conversely, tracked chippers serve as self-propelled units purpose-built for environments where towable machines cannot access close proximity to the task area.
Crawler machinery has proven cost- and time-effective in situations involving hard-to-access terrains. The chipper travels directly to the timber when faced with hilly terrain, unstable ground, areas with trees that vehicles cannot reach, or locations where considerable manual transport from the nearest solid surface. This removes the labourious alternative of transporting wood to the machine.

Shredder cutting edges and anvils can deteriorate most rapidly. Operating a chipper with worn blades not simply reduces efficiency but also places additional strain on the engine, hydraulic feed mechanism, and flywheel, consequently impacting the longevity of other parts of the machine. Do I need a licence to tow a wood chipper?
Thinking about a 6-inch towable chipper? Exciting news! The vast majority come in at less than 750kg, so you can tow them along with just your standard Category B driving licence. Considering the larger 8-inch models? These hefty machines often tip the scales beyond 750kg, meaning you’ll need that B+E (trailer) licence to legally tow them legally. Not sure about the weight? Don’t worry! Just contact us when booking and we’ll happily confirm exactly how heavy your specific machine is. Easy peasy!
